Output 168f68cdab35bfb43c26c6c887921a17c39c2ef2c6f6b4b6fd5a14587e55619a:2

value
1136056
script pubkey
OP_0 OP_PUSHBYTES_32 d9109c9ef0160f075cd205d45aaac5c4f45870f305d08725d9c8f05518396b60
address
bc1qmygfe8hszc8swhxjqh2942k9cn69su8nqhggwfweerc92xpeddsql0yxgl
transaction
168f68cdab35bfb43c26c6c887921a17c39c2ef2c6f6b4b6fd5a14587e55619a
spent
true